My Words of Tshuvah

The Ausblick
Fall, 2005
By Donna Spiegelman

The Days of Awe come once more. The past year is reviewed, the book for next year is written and sealed.
 
In these Days, we, the descendants of Abraham and Sarah, ask for a year of attainment and success, peace and security, plenty and delight. We ask forgiveness for violence, oppressing others, callousness, obstinacy, and evading responsibility.
We can achieve none of this if we forget the fact that God promised to
make the descendants of Abraham and Hagar a great nation too.
 
As for individuals, so it is for nation-states. We, the people of Israel,  must reflect on what the year's book will say about the State of Israel.
 
My devout hope is that 5765 will have seen an initial successful move toward real peace: the orderly relocation of Jews from the Gaza Strip, their places taken by Palestinians.
 
For 5766,  I hope for more comprehensive and peaceful relocations, from the West Bank, until there exist two nation-states living side by side in harmony, sharing resources and prosperity.
 
The State of Israel's constructive role in this process will truly make it a light unto the world.
